  • Pros
    • Trekking in a national park, a cultural stay in Santiago or relaxing on the coast, Chile offers a diversity of scenery that allows all sorts of combinations of holidays.
    • It is without doubt the safest country in Latin America.
    • People travelling through it in a car or as an "autotour" package will experience a real "road movie" on the southern motorway taking them to Patagonia.
  • Cons
    • Huge distances, particularly when you have to cover them in a bus. Allow for time and a number of nights on this means of transport.
    • Expect sharp changes of climate in the south of the continent.
    • The cost of living. As opposed to its northern neighbours, Bolivia and Peru, Chile is quite an expensive country.
